Students from grades 1 to 9 were teaching people from the community recently.

“This is amazing!!” and “How does that work!?” was what you could hear in the hallways of the RCS with the faint background murmurs of the RCS community while they got together to learn.

Some of the titles read Squirt!, Wind Tunnel, Photosynthesis, and Distracted Driving. The titles were catchy, bold and interesting.

People who came to the science fair were amazed at the creations of the students such as walking a balloon one metre, driving distracted, spraying water with low pressure and a barometer.

The main idea of this science fair was to have fun, get together and learn new things.

Sometimes it was not the student teaching the guests; sometimes the guests or other students taught the students.

Some students started off scared because it was their first science fair but as the crowd grew larger they got more confident.
